Hope and Healing In a Broken World
In a world that often feels irreparably broken, can we truly live whole? In Living Whole, Julie Gariss takes readers on a seven-week journey through the remarkable life of Joseph, demonstrating how faith, forgiveness, and God's unwavering presence can restore wholeness to shattered lives.
This study guide delves into the highs and lows of Joseph's story--from betrayal and slavery to forgiveness and leadership--offering timeless lessons on resilience, faith, and divine providence. Each week offers daily readings, reflective questions, and practical applications to inspire self-reflection, foster group discussions, and strengthen your relationship with God.
